About

a completely normal dating simulation that is definitely completely sweet, innnocent and normal: SOMETHINGETH ANIVERSARY EDITION is a single player simulation game. It was developed by Educated Child Games and was released on August 26, 2022. It received very positive reviews from players.

a fun dating sim where you get to date stick figures! that might sound dumb, but trust me when i say that the stick figures in question are, like... the SMEXIEST STICK FIGURES EVER. they also have very good and real personalities, just like real people! so really, it's just like dating an actual stick figure! except through a computer screen! so... i guess.. it's just like having an internet boyfr…

  • The game features a unique and engaging storyline that cleverly subverts typical dating sim tropes, providing humor and unexpected twists.
  • The art style and character designs are vibrant and expressive, enhancing the overall immersive experience.
  • The soundtrack is catchy and complements the game's whimsical tone, contributing to the emotional impact of the narrative.
  • Many players found the repetitive dialogue and low-quality writing to be tedious and unengaging, detracting from the overall experience.
  • The game is perceived by some as a poorly executed joke or e-book rather than a serious game, leading to disappointment among players expecting more depth.
  • The humor and absurdity may not resonate with everyone, leaving some players feeling confused or frustrated rather than entertained.
  • music
    24 mentions Positive Neutral Negative

    The music in the game has received overwhelmingly positive feedback, with players praising its emotional depth, catchy tunes, and ability to enhance the overall experience. The soundtrack is described as whimsical and perfectly suited to the game's tone, featuring memorable songs that resonate with both humorous and romantic moments. Many players expressed a desire for the soundtrack to be available for download, highlighting its impact on their enjoyment of the game.

  • humor
    15 mentions Positive Neutral Negative

    The humor in the game is polarizing, with some players appreciating its self-referential jokes and absurdity, while others find it unfunny and poorly executed. While certain elements, like the character "Sharky Warky," elicited genuine laughter for some, many reviewers felt the humor fell flat or was too niche to resonate widely. Overall, the comedic approach is hit-or-miss, appealing to a specific audience but leaving others disappointed.
